What are Children's Hanfu Fake Collars?

Children's Hanfu fake collars are replicas of traditional Hanfu collars designed for children. These collars are made using modern materials but are designed to mimic the appearance and style of authentic Hanfu collars. They are often less expensive than genuine Hanfu collars and provide a great way for children to wear traditional-style clothing without the need for full authentic attire.

Types of Children's Hanfu Fake Collars

  1. Traditional Style Collars: These collars closely resemble the original Hanfu collars, with intricate patterns and designs. They are often made using synthetic materials that mimic the look and feel of traditional fabrics like silk or cotton.

  2. Modern Fusion Collars: These collars combine traditional Hanfu elements with modern designs and materials. They are often more comfortable for children to wear and are easier to find in various sizes and styles.

  3. Adjustable Collars: These collars come with adjustable features that allow parents to customize the fit for their children. They are often made using elastic materials that provide a comfortable fit and allow for growth over time.

How to Choose Children's Hanfu Fake Collars?

When choosing children's Hanfu fake collars, it is essential to consider the following factors:

  1. Material: Look for collars made using comfortable materials that are suitable for children's skin. Avoid materials that may cause discomfort or irritation.

  2. Size and Fit: Choose a collar that fits your child comfortably and allows for growth over time. Adjustable collars provide a great option for growing children.

  3. Design and Style: Select a collar with a design that reflects your child's personality and style preferences. Traditional style collars provide a classic look, while modern fusion collars offer a blend of traditional and modern elements.

  4. Quality: Look for collars that are well-made and have good attention to detail. Avoid buying cheap, poor-quality collars that may not last long or look authentic.
